require('ts-node/register/transpile-only');
const assert = require('node:assert/strict');
const { test } = require('node:test');
const {
createLocalProcessDurableHandle,
} = require('../../back/runtime/adapters/local-process/localProcessIdentity');
const {
LocalProcessPersistedExecutionController,
} = require('../../back/runtime/adapters/local-process/persistedLocalProcessController');
const IDENTITY = {
platform: 'linux',
bootId: '11111111-2222-3333-4444-555555555555',
pid: 4321,
processGroupId: 4321,
startTimeTicks: '123456',
};
const HANDLE = createLocalProcessDurableHandle('handle-1', IDENTITY);
function controller(inspections, overrides = {}) {
const signals = [];
let index = 0;
return {
signals,
value: new LocalProcessPersistedExecutionController({
identityProvider: {
async capture() {
throw new Error('not used');
},
async inspect(identity) {
assert.deepEqual(identity, IDENTITY);
const status = inspections[Math.min(index, inspections.length - 1)];
index += 1;
return { status };
},
},
sendSignal(pid, signal) {
signals.push({ pid, signal });
},
graceMs: 10,
pollIntervalMs: 5,
sleep: async () => undefined,
...overrides,
}),
};
}
const REASON = { kind: 'user', requestedAtMs: 1_750_000_000_000 };
test('refuses malformed, PID-mismatched, and non-leader handles without signals', async () => {
const instance = controller(['running']);
assert.equal(
(await instance.value.stop({ durableHandle: 'bad', reason: REASON }))
.status,
'invalid',
);
assert.equal(
(
await instance.value.stop({
durableHandle: HANDLE,
expectedPid: 9999,
reason: REASON,
})
).status,
'pid_mismatch',
);
const nonLeader = createLocalProcessDurableHandle('handle-2', {
...IDENTITY,
processGroupId: 4000,
});
assert.equal(
(await instance.value.stop({ durableHandle: nonLeader, reason: REASON }))
.status,
'identity_mismatch',
);
assert.deepEqual(instance.signals, []);
});
test('sends TERM only when the persisted process exits during grace', async () => {
const instance = controller(['running', 'exited']);
const result = await instance.value.stop({
durableHandle: HANDLE,
expectedPid: 4321,
reason: REASON,
});
assert.deepEqual(result, {
status: 'termination_requested',
termSignalSent: true,
killSignalSent: false,
});
assert.deepEqual(instance.signals, [{ pid: -4321, signal: 'SIGTERM' }]);
});
test('revalidates identity before escalating a persistent process to KILL', async () => {
const persistent = controller(['running', 'running', 'running', 'running']);
const killed = await persistent.value.stop({
durableHandle: HANDLE,
reason: REASON,
});
assert.equal(killed.killSignalSent, true);
assert.deepEqual(persistent.signals, [
{ pid: -4321, signal: 'SIGTERM' },
{ pid: -4321, signal: 'SIGKILL' },
]);
const changed = controller([
'running',
'running',
'running',
'identity_mismatch',
]);
const refused = await changed.value.stop({
durableHandle: HANDLE,
reason: REASON,
});
assert.equal(refused.status, 'identity_mismatch');
assert.equal(refused.killSignalSent, false);
assert.deepEqual(changed.signals, [{ pid: -4321, signal: 'SIGTERM' }]);
});
test('treats an already exited process and ESRCH as idempotent completion', async () => {
const exited = controller(['exited']);
assert.deepEqual(
await exited.value.stop({ durableHandle: HANDLE, reason: REASON }),
{
status: 'already_exited',
termSignalSent: false,
killSignalSent: false,
},
);
const noProcess = controller(['running'], {
sendSignal() {
const error = new Error('gone');
error.code = 'ESRCH';
throw error;
},
});
assert.equal(
(await noProcess.value.stop({ durableHandle: HANDLE, reason: REASON }))
.status,
'already_exited',
);
});
